How can silent data corruption be detected and corrected in AI systems?

July 9, 2025 By Jeff Shepard Leave a Comment

Silent data corruption (SDC), sometimes called bit rot or silent data errors (SDEs), refers to errors in data that are not detected by standard error-checking mechanisms, leading to potentially significant data loss or incorrect calculations. SDCs can lead to inaccurate training, incorrect predictions, and unreliable performance. Detecting SDC requires specialized techniques and tools. SDCs can […]

How does the Zenoh protocol enhance edge device operation?

July 2, 2025 By Jeff Shepard Leave a Comment

Zenoh is an open-source platform that manages data in transit and at rest across the entire edge-to-cloud continuum, as well as facilitates computations on edge devices. Targeted applications include robotics, automotive, and IoT. Its low overhead makes it compatible with low-power or bandwidth-limited networks like LPWAN, LoWPAN, and Bluetooth Low Energy (BLE).
